    Features of Energy Storage Container Energy Storage System
    1. High degree of system integration, integrated battery management system, PCS, temperature control system, fire control system, access control system, data monitoring system, AC and DC power distribution, lighting system, etc.
    2. Customizable design to meet different customer needs.
    3. Third-level BMS system architecture, safe and reliable.
    4. The charging mode includes pre-charging, constant-current charging, uniform charging and floating charging.
    5. The energy storage system has perfect functions of communication, monitoring, management, control, early warning and protection. It operates continuously and safely for a long time. It can detect the running state of the system through the upper computer. It has abundant data analysis ability and emergency power supply function.

    Application Scenario of Energy Storage Container Energy Storage System
    1. PV station 2. Wind Grid side power station 3. Frequency regulation 4. Grid side 5. Industrial and commercial
    -New-energy generation:Effectively smoothen the power output to decrease the impact to the grid
    -Generate according to the plan and correct forecast errors
    -Reduce the peak and fill the valley
    -Grid frequency modulation with AVC and AGC functions
    -Electricity of transmission and distribution
    -Smart Grid - Micro-grid - Reduce the peak and fill the valley
    -Smelter, chemical plant, paper mill, airport, wharf and others.
